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ature vocale voile
Definition Féminin singulier de vocal. Large pièce de tissu assurant la propulsion des navires ou des moulins, par la force du vent.

vocale is recorded at frequency rank #12,884, classified as anadj, pronounced \vɔ.kal\. voile is at rank #2,653, tagged as anoun, pronounced \vwal\.
